Appoquinimink center fielder Lorenzo Carrier is the Player of the Year and heads the All-State baseball team selected by the Delaware Baseball Coaches Association.

The 6-foot-6 Carrier hit .547 with four home runs, four triples and 11 doubles in 53 at-bats this spring. He also drove in 36 runs and was perfect in 22 stolen-base attempts for the Jaguars.

The senior has signed to play college baseball at Miami (Florida), but is also expected to be selected in the Major League Baseball draft this summer.

Carrier leads a list of 13 first-team All-State players, along with fellow outfielders Mike Mallamaci of Archmere, Jonathan Stokley of Sussex Tech and Alec Rodriguez of Dover.

The first-team pitchers are Zach Hart of St. Georges and Christian Colmery of St. Mark’s, with Sussex Tech’s Jason Shockley voted as the top catcher.

The first-team infielders are Sussex Central’s A.J. Cannon (first base), Smyrna’s Connor Strauss (second base), Conrad’s Tyler Pirrung (third base) and Concord’s Luke Gabrysh (shortstop).

Middletown’s Zak Sophy was voted the top designated hitter, and Delmarva Christian’s Riley Culver made the first team as a utility player.

The Coach of the Year is St. Georges’ Jeff Rodgers, who guided the Hawks to a 16-2 regular season and the No. 1 seed in the DIAA Baseball Tournament.

Tower Hill’s Paul Gillerlain was named the Assistant Coach of the Year.
